Neighborhood Note:
Inwood, like much of northern Manhattan, was once a tranquil, pastoral area before the arrival of mass transit in the early 20th century. Historic landmarks still remainsuch as the Seaman-Drake Arch, Manhattan's only free-standing arch outside of Washington Square Park, and the Dyckman Farmhouse, the borough's oldest remaining Dutch Colonial-style structure. Inwood's architectural charm also includes 1930s Art Deco apartment buildings and a collection of two-story Tudor and Colonial Revival homes dating back to the 1920s. As the northernmost tip of the islandjust past Marble HillInwood offers a distinctive and graceful close to Manhattan's timeless allure.
